2016-05-30 7 views
1

C#言語仕様のWebページを読んでください https://msdn.microsoft.com/en-us/library/aa664665(v=vs.71).aspx 空白を定義するコンテキストで、「UnicodeクラスZsを持つ任意の文字」というテキストがあります。C#言語仕様では、「UnicodeクラスZsを持つ任意の文字」は何を意味していますか?

「UnicodeクラスZsを持つ任意の文字」はどういう意味ですか?

regexタグを追加して、正規表現にリンクされている可能性があります。

+0

参照:http://stackoverflow.com/questions/3742495/where-can-i-get-a-list-of-unicode-chars-by-class –

答えて

1

Unicodeコードポイントには、それぞれに割り当てられた分類があります。 Zsクラスのコードポイントは"Separator, Space"カテゴリに属します。

+0

それは本当に良いです、私はhttp://stackoverflow.com/questions/4731055/whitespace-matching-regex-javaを参照してください。この文字のすべてが正規表現[\ s \ u0085 \ p {Z}]と一致していますか? –

+0

これは今受け入れますが、Javaの正規表現をテストして[\ s \ u0085 \ p {Z}]が動作するかどうかを調べます。ありがとう。 –

関連する問題